what are the 4 categories of dessert wines

late harvested, frozen grape, fortified , dried grape

35
New cards

what is a late harvested dessert wine

grapes left longer on the vine that either shrivel and become raisin or get noble rot from a mold called botrytis

36
New cards

what are frozen grape wines

made in cooler climates wherre the grape is left to freeze on the vine then picked and pressed while frozen

37
New cards

what are fortified wines

wines that are fortified with a neutral grape brandy

38
New cards

what are dried grape wines

grapes that are dried off the vines, which taken on a flavor of dried fruit
